Gangloneuroblastoma in posterior mediastinum: A case report

Description

Ganglioneuroblastoma is the neurogenic tumor arising from the sympathetic ganglia which extends from the base of skull to the pelvis including the suprarenal medulla. Pathologically it belongs to the intermediate group between malignant neuroblastoma and benign ganglioneuroma. It most frequently occurs in the infant and young children, predominantly at the posterior mediastinum. Here the authors report a case of ganglioneuroblastoma of posterior mediastinum in a 12 year old boy which was recently confirmed histopathologically at Severance Hospital, Yonsei University. Radiological aspect are reviewed as well as clinical and pathological aspects along with brief review of references
